In the Linux kernel, the following vulnerability has been resolved:

exfat: use kvmalloc_array/kvfree instead of kmalloc_array/kfree

The call stack shown below is a scenario in the Linux 4.19 kernel.
Allocating memory failed where exfat fs use kmalloc_array due to
system memory fragmentation, while the u-disk was inserted without
recognition.
Devices such as u-disk using the exfat file system are pluggable and
may be insert into the system at any time.
However, long-term running systems cannot guarantee the continuity of
physical memory. Therefore, it's necessary to address this issue.

By analyzing the exfat code,we found that continuous physical memory
is not required here,so kvmalloc_array is used can solve this problem.
